SMRT extends trains and bus service hours on the eve of Deepavali
Train services, all feeder bus services as well as Bus Services 67, 857, 960 and 980 which pass through Little India will be extended on the eve of Deepavali on Friday, 1 November.
Last train timings
- The last trains on NSEWL will depart City Hall MRT station at 12.30am.
- The last CCL train ending at HarbourFront will depart Dhoby Ghaut at 11.55pm.
- The last CCL train ending at Dhoby Ghaut will depart HarbourFront at 11.30pm.
Last bus timings
SMRT feeder services at Bukit Batok, Choa Chu Kang, Woodlands, Sembawang and Yishun Interchanges will be extended. Bus services 67, 857, 960 and 980 which pass through Little India will also be extended.

SMRT Corporation Ltd (SMRT) is the leading multi-modal public transport operator in Singapore. SMRT serves millions of passengers daily by offering a safe, reliable and comprehensive transport network that consists of an extensive MRT and light rail system which connects seamlessly with its island-wide bus and taxi operations. SMRT also markets and leases the commercial and media spaces within its transport network, and offers engineering consultancy and project management as well as operations and maintenance services, locally and internationally.
